1、登录MySQL
在Linux终端中,首先需要通过命令行登录到MySQL服务器,使用命令mysql u username p
,其中username
是你的MySQL用户名,执行该命令后,系统会提示你输入密码。
2、选择数据库
成功登录后,选择你想要查看表的数据库,使用命令USE database_name;
来选择数据库,这条命令将把后续的操作指向你指定的数据库。
3、查看数据库列表
若要查看可用的数据库列表,可以使用命令SHOW DATABASES;
,执行这条命令后,你将看到服务器上所有数据库的列表。
4、查看表列表
确定了数据库后,使用命令SHOW TABLES;
来列出该数据库中的所有表,这个命令会展示出当前选定数据库中的所有表的名称,从而可以继续进行下一步的数据查看或管理操作。
5、查看表数据
找到具体的表后,你可以使用SELECT * FROM table_name;
命令来查看表中的数据,这将显示表中所有的数据行和列,为数据的进一步分析或操作提供基础。
6、表结构查看
如果需要查看表的结构,可以使用DESCRIBE table_name;
命令,这将展示表中每个列的数据类型、是否允许NULL值以及其他相关信息,有助于了解表的详细设计结构。
自动补全和命令纠正
在Linux环境中,Tab键的自动补全功能可以帮助用户快速完成命令的输入,减少拼写错误的可能。
如果在输入MySQL命令时出现错误,可以使用向上箭头键回顾之前的命令,进行修改和重新执行。
常用别名和简化操作
为了提高操作效率,可以为常用的较长命令设置别名,将SHOW DATABASES;
设置为show dbs;
。
在频繁访问特定数据库时,可以将使用频率较高的数据库设置为默认数据库,避免每次登录后都需要手动选择数据库。
数据安全和备份
定期使用mysqldump
工具进行数据库备份,确保数据不会因意外损坏而丢失。
使用权限控制命令如GRANT
和REVOKE
来管理用户对特定数据库或表的访问,增强数据安全性。
通过以上步骤和技巧,用户可以有效地管理和查看Linux环境下MySQL数据库中的表,这些操作不仅可以帮助数据库管理员维护和监控数据库状态,也为数据分析和应用程序开发提供了必要的支持。